Arts & Culture
Ethnographic museum with a wide range of interesting artefacts including shrunken heads and a witch in a bottle! Go through the Natural History Museum to the very back and you will find it. We would recommend spending 2 hours here.

Museum with a large collection of art and artefacts of ethnographic importance. Free entry for the main museum with special exhibitions which are paid for. Closed on Mondays. There is a nice restaurant at the very top.

Easy place to go for a walk or a jog. Lots of nice paths and wildlife to see including Binsey Lane Nature Reserve. Accessed by walking to the end of Longwell Road and over the railway bridges. It is the largest free land in Europe. Note: the map is slightly misleading and it is only about 5 minutes walk from our place.
